Description
Creamy Ranch Chicken features tender seared chicken breasts smothered in a rich, garlicky ranch sauce made with sour cream and herbs.
Ingredients
2 large boneless chicken breasts
½ teaspoon garlic powder
1 teaspoon mixed herbs
½ teaspoon salt
½ teaspoon pepper
1 tablespoon olive oil
1½ tablespoons butter
1 tablespoon minced garlic
1 tablespoon flour
1 cup chicken stock
¼ cup sour cream
1½ tablespoons ranch seasoning
Instructions
1. Cut chicken breasts horizontally into cutlets.
2. Mix garlic powder, mixed herbs, salt, and pepper; season both sides of chicken.
3. Heat olive oil and 1½ tablespoons butter in a skillet.
4. Sear chicken for 3–4 minutes per side until golden; remove and set aside.
5. Add butter to the same skillet, then sauté garlic for 30 seconds.
6. Stir in flour and cook another 30 seconds.
7. Slowly whisk in chicken stock until smooth.
8. Lower heat, add sour cream and ranch seasoning, and stir well.
9. Return chicken to the pan and spoon sauce over top before serving.
Notes
Add vegetables like mushrooms or spinach for variation.
Use Greek yogurt instead of sour cream for a lighter version.
Pair with rice, mashed potatoes, or noodles.
